What to check before for buildings with rent-stabilized apartments near the Q32 bus in NYC

  • Start with the building page to confirm the rent-stabilized status and how the unit’s lease is structured (renewal, increases, and timing can vary).
  • Filter further with “with available apartments” if you need a move-in date soon, and verify the exact apartment features and rent shown for the specific unit.
  • Read tenant Q&A for practical issues like maintenance response, noise, and common-area access; then ask follow-up questions on anything you see repeatedly.
  • Use the building’s contact and document checklist to confirm what you must provide (income, ID, references) and any application steps required for rent-stabilized units.
  • Before signing, confirm the full cost beyond the monthly rent, including broker fees (if applicable), security deposit, and any recurring charges listed in the lease addendum.
